Parth Deveshbhai Birje, born on September 17, 1993, from Ahmedabad, Gujarat, has achieved a remarkable milestone as a specially-abled artist with 50% mental disability. A proud student of Navjeevan Charitable Trust, Parth performed the Congo (hand drum) on 101+ different language songs, showcasing his extraordinary talent and dedication.
His outstanding accomplishment was officially certified by the World Records of India and the Genius Foundation on March 9, 2023. Trained under the guidance of his father, Parth’s unique skill earned him recognition not only in India but also internationally.
Recently, Parth represented India at the International Special Art and Music Festival 2023 held in South Korea, where he mesmerized audiences with his congo performances.
